Check Point V-80 (Quantum Spark 1590 Appliance) is an Appliance, based on Armada 8040 (88F8040). Specification: - SoC : Marvell Armada 8040 (88F8040) - RAM : DDR4 2 GiB (4x 512 MiB chip) - Flash : eMMC 4 GiB - Ethernet : 10x 10/100/1000 Mbps - LAN 1-8 : Marvell 88E6393X - WAN : Marvell 88E1512 - DMZ : Marvell 88E1512 (RJ-45/SFP combo) - LEDs/Keys (GPIO): 11x/1x - UART : "CONSOLE" port (USB 1.1 Type-C) - chip : Silicon Labs CP2102N - port : ttyS0 - settings : 115200bps 8n1 - HW Monitoring : 2x nuvoTon NCT7802Y - USB : USB 3.0 Type-A - Power : 12 VDC, 3.3 A - plug : DC Plug 2.5/5.5 mm (inner/outer) Flash instruction (common): 1. Boot V-81 normally 2. Login to the vendor CLI (default: admin/admin) and login to the Linux CLI by `expert` command 3. Update U-Boot environment variables by the following commands fw_setenv bootcmd_ow_usb 'usb start; load usb 0:1 ${loadaddr} boot.scr && source ${loadaddr}' fw_setenv bootcmd_ow_sd 'load mmc 0:1 ${loadaddr} boot.scr && source ${loadaddr}' fw_setenv bootcmd_ow_emmc 'run set_mmc_internal; mmc read ${loadaddr} ${prim_header_mmc_blk} 4 && source ${loadaddr}' fw_setenv bootcmd 'run bootcmd_ow_usb; run bootcmd_ow_sd; run bootcmd_ow_emmc; run bootcmd_part${activePartition};' Attention: don't forget single quatations of values to prevent expansion of variables 4. Turn off the device Flash instruction (USB-boot/SD-boot): 1. Extract and burn (squashfs|ext4)-sdcard.img.gz to USB storage or MicroSD card 2. Connect that storage to V-81 3. Turn on V-81 and it will be booted with OpenWrt in that USB storage Flash instruction (eMMC-boot): 1. Copy initramfs image, dtb and bootsctipt to the USB storage with renaming initramfs.bin -------> Image dtb -----------------> armada-8040-v-81.dtb bootscript (.scr) ---> boot.scr 2. Connect that storage to the USB 3.0 port on V-81 3. Turn on V-81 and it will be booted with OpenWrt initramfs image in that USB storage 4. Upload (squashfs|ext4)-sysupgrade.gz to V-81 5. Perform sysupgrade with the uploaded image 6. Wait ~100 seconds to complete flashing Reverting to stock firmware: 1. Turn on V-81 and interrupt booting by Ctrl + C 2. Select "4. Restore to Factory Defaults (local)" 3. Wait ~180 seconds to complete restoring and rebooting Notes: - The partition table in the internal eMMC has single partition, but "blkdevparts=" parameter will be passed from the bootloader and that definition will be used instead. - The port-side LED pairs of RJ-45/SFP ports on V-81 are switched by a GPIO pin of pin7 on &cp0_gpio2. (High(1): RJ-45, Low(0): SFP) This needs to be switched manually. - The MicroSD card slot is too unstable and the following messages are printed without "marvell,xenon-phy-slow-mode;" property. [ 97.060851] mmc0: error -84 whilst initialising SD card [ 97.137049] mmc0: error -84 whilst initialising SD card [ 97.214315] mmc0: error -84 whilst initialising SD card ... - There are no detailed information about maximum power consumption limit of the SFP port or optional DSL-SFP modules sold officially. But the power requirement of almost DSL-SFP modules are 3.3V/700mA, so set the maximum value of the SFP port to 2000 mW (Power Level III). - Do not insert a MicroSD card before turning of the device when OpenWrt installation. The stock firmware deletes all files in the first partition automatically, to use it as a storage for logs.
